| 27th March 2004 Coal Exchange 2 v 2 Pulborough Res Div 4 South Pulborough Reserves turned up at Fortress Emsworth with an army of supporters and a few selected 'first teamers' on saturday to continue the recent rivally. Pulborough had the upper hand for the first 15 minutes or so, but we battled our way back into the game with Chalkie, Bran, Geoffer and Danny, providing some good balls from the midfield and Lee and Keith chasing everything up front. We were unlucky to go in at half-time 2 v 1 down. We had a stand-in keeper this week, Dale, who played well behind the solid Coalie defense...Scholes, Andy, Jezzer and Simon. Chris came on in the second half to work his magic down the left wing. We had some great chances in the second half. Danny, Geoffer, and Keithy all missing from close-in, but on the final whistle it all came good when Lee Good smashed in his second of the game to level the game 2 v 2. It felt like a victory!! Next week we are at home to Fernhurst. |

| 13th March 2004 Fernhurst Res 2 v 3 Coal Exchange Div 4 South After last weeks goal drought there were bound to be a few goals around this week and that was the way this game panned out. Fernhurst is a beautiful little village but their football pitch was a slopping slippery monster. Despite that we managed to play some inspired passing football (not always to the right team) and came out 3 v 2 winners to keep the pressure up for that last promotion spot. Chalkie chalked up his first goal of the season with a tap in after battling attacking play from Keith and Lee Good. Choz and Bran battled away in the midfield while the Gaffa tried to make it a fair game by passing to the opposition every chance he got. Scholes, Jez, Soiller, Chris and Brian kept the defense as solid as a Mount Vesuvius rock and Jon returned to goal this week and played out of his skin as usual. |

| 6th March 2004 Pulborough 0 v 0 Coal Exchange Div 4 South We lost to Pulborough 5 v 1 earlier in the season, so the lads approached this game with some trepidation. It was a fantastic battling performance to produce the first ever goaless draw in the history of the Coal Exchange Football Club. Maybe there's a good omen for Pompey when Arsenal revisit!! We started well with Bran, Jez, Giggs and Fellows linking up well in the midfield. Lee and Keith had a few chances and were unlucky not to snatch a winner towards the end, but it was the defense who really showed their quality today. Chopper Oiller let no man live down the left, Scholes and Andy sewed up the centre and Chris chased everything down the right. Geoff went in goal in the absence of Jon and performed heroics despite a few heart stopping moments, and earned Coalies first clean sheet of the season!!! |

| 28th Feb 2004 Coal Exchange 1 v 2 Lodsworth Div 4 South The Coalie once again managed to snatch defeat from the jaws of victory this week. Lodsworth scored first with a glancing header, but the Coalie fought back and after a tencious run and pass (yes it's true) from Keithy, Lee Good tapped in the equaliser. This inspired the team and the midfield quartet Bran, Geoffer, Chalkie and Danny provided quality service for the front men and the defense Scholes, Andy, Jessie and Simon protected Jon in goal. The game changed when Lodsworth had a player sent off. Lodsworth found renewed determination and the Coalie seemed to start playing like a bunch of girls (sorry girls)!!! Even the introduction of Brian and three centre forwards (four including Geoff) couldn't rescue the game. Lodsworth scored another headed goal and took the three points back the hills from whence they came. |
